Transaction 5924540bf81d07f9d172eb2a595590146dc279a367a4dd9bb7bb2ae1f07615ef

2 Input
2 Outputs
  • 5924540bf81d07f9d172eb2a595590146dc279a367a4dd9bb7bb2ae1f07615ef:0
  • value  663000
    address  173NCCsSHasn2sCaFy39hJ6aW4GJNmkuX8
  • 5924540bf81d07f9d172eb2a595590146dc279a367a4dd9bb7bb2ae1f07615ef:1
  • value  1394106
    address  3AEkFyFjNnYmyU2upUP69cMxKpAZuyFEHM